Subject: Panic attacks/anxiety
Written By: quirky_cat_girl on 01/28/08 at 9:25 am
Have any of you ever suffered from panic attacks or severe anxiety? What did you do to remedy the situation? If you opted for meds, which ones did/do you feel helped you the most?
Subject: Re: Panic attacks/anxiety
Written By: CatwomanofV on 01/28/08 at 11:22 am
Oh yeah, every time I fly. I recognize the fact that it is only anxiety. I try to take deep breaths, listen to music and Carlos is so nice to hold my hand. Also, a few drinks doesn't hurt either. ;) I also have the same thing when I have to have a needle (whether it be to get a shot or if they have to take blood). Again, I take deep breaths and it does help that Carlos holds my hand. ;D ;D ;D
I am aware that these two situations causes my attacks so I try to counter them.
I have come to the conclusion that I could never give blood. I tried one time and I started hyperventilating, my heart was pounding, and I started crying-and they didn't even get the needle into me.

I have anxiety attacks in very high-stress situations.
I opt for drinking teas that are specifically for calming down.
Soothing music tends to help out.
I try to stay away from medications, because the Mood stabilizer I'm on is supposed to keep me on an even keel.
However, natural herbs do tend to help- and I don't mean "Mary Jane".
Things like mint, valerian, Kava kava....that kinda stuff.

I used to get them very badly back in my late teens early twenties. I went down the route of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T) because I didn't want to take anti-depressants. It worked really well for me.
